You can easily link to terms in wikis and various other websites using a simplified markup syntax. For example, "[prefix:some term]" creates a hyperlink to the "some term" article on the website specified by "prefix." It is also possible to use the "|" character to create a "piped link," with display text that is different from the search term. For example, "[w:public transport|public transportation]" would be translated as a reference to an article about "public transport" that displays as "public transportation."
